Every day we take time out of our hectic schedules to clean our teeth. Toothbrush, floss & other dental materials help prevent harmful oral bacteria, bad breathe & dental staining. However, theres a lot of misinformation out there regarding how to brush & floss correctly. In every household you can find a toothbrush. Toothbrushes come in many sizes, shapes & forms. . . some are power driven & some are not. Both types are recommended as long as you use the correct technique When using a toothbrush, it is essential to clean all surfaces of your teeth. The toothbrush should be positioned at a 45 degree angle between your gums & teeth since this is an interface where bacteria can proliferate easily. Please take some time to brush around the entire tooth since there are many grooves and pits on the surfaces of your teeth. Don’t forget the areas closest to your tongue. Saliva can cause calcification which makes it harder to maintain a clean surface. It is typically recommended that you spend 2 minutes brushing in the morning and immediately before bed. Excellent brushing habits take time but it is a worthwhile investment that is essential for a beautiful smile. While the toothbrush cleans around your teeth, flossing cleans in between. The vast majority of our teeth come into contact with one another. These contact areas cannot be cleaned effectively with the toothbrush alone. A thin piece of floss allows you to reach into these tight areas & clean out any remaining food particles. Wrap the floss around your middle fingers which will allow your index fingers to easily manipulate the floss. Most people floss quickly going between each contact. However, take some time to create a “C” shape around each tooth & pull outwards. This motion will keep the area between your teeth clean. Flossing & brushing together are essential for quality oral hygiene. I hope you use this video as a tool the next time you clean your teeth.
